Calgary mayor Naheed Nenshi says arena talks with Flames aren’t dead
Calgary mayor Naheed Nenshi says the city remains at the negotiating table for a new NHL arena even though the Flames have declared they’ve pulled out of talks.
The NHL team is frustrated with “spectacularly unproductive” negotiations, according to team president Ken King.
“We remain ready to negotiate in good faith,” the mayor countered Wednesday.
“Council understands the importance of the Flames to this city, council understands the importance of having the Flames downtown.
